Workshop on Trust, Capacity and Accountability in South African primary schools

On the 24th October 2022, JET Education Services, in partnership with the Vrije Universiteit Amsterdam (VU) and the UK Open University (OU), hosted a live roundtable discussion on the results of the Trust, Capacity and Accountability study conducted in South African primary schools.
